Ashok Leyland, a prominent company of the Hinduja Group, stands as India’s second-largest commercial vehicle manufacturer and a global leader in the p Read more roduction of buses and trucks. It supplies four out of five STU buses in major Indian cities, including distinctive double-decker and vestibule models, showcasing its dominance in the sector.

With a vision of "Global Standards, Global Markets," the organisation prioritised early advancements in its products and processes. It became India’s first automobile company to achieve ISO 9002 certification in 1993, followed by ISO 9001, QS 9000, and ISO 14001. In 2006, it further cemented its commitment to quality with the ISO/TS 16949 certification.

    • Water Initiatives

      Description

      Ashok Leyland Limited prioritizes water conservation and sustainable water management as part of its community and environmental initiatives. It has implemented a water body restoration and optimization program to enhance water resources for communities. Through the SUJAL project in Alwar, Rajasthan, it constructed 150 roof rainwater harvesting tanks, creating a storage capacity of 2,261 cubic meters and benefiting over 2,000 people. Additionally, it revived two ponds, impacting 11,545 family members, and supported 36 farmers by installing irrigation pipelines spanning 8,918.92 meters to promote efficient agricultural water use.

    • Healthcare

      Description

      Ashok Leyland Limited focuses on improving health care for the commercial vehicle community, addressing lifestyle-related health issues such as incorrect eyesight, hypertension, diabetes, tuberculosis, and AIDS. It established a Mobile Medical Unit (MMU) staffed by medical professionals and social workers to provide free health services in selected regions. The MMU conducts health education, screenings for hypertension and diabetes, eyesight correction, and AIDS awareness, along with promoting overall health and wellness within the community.

    • Social Development Initiatives

      Description

      Ashok Leyland Limited, through its RTS Social Development Initiatives, promotes the socio-emotional well-being of students and encourages community ownership in education to create a sustainable learning environment. It adopts a dual approach involving in-school and community interventions. In schools, it conducts wellness sessions for students in grades 1-8, addresses topics like ‘safe and unsafe touch’ and menstrual hygiene, and promotes cleanliness with student participation. It also strengthens School Management Committees (SMC) to enhance community involvement. In surrounding communities, it supports health and hygiene awareness, facilitates access to government schemes, and promotes inclusivity for marginalized groups, ensuring an improved quality of life.

    • Road to School

      Description

      Ashok Leyland Limited extends its commitment to a better and inclusive future through its CSR programs, focusing on education, livelihood, community development, and climate change. Its Road to School (RTS) and Road to Livelihood (RTL) initiatives have expanded to benefit over 150,000 children across nearly 1,400 schools in five Indian states, up from 96,750 students. Guided by the philosophy of "Education as a Social Leveler," these programs emphasize holistic and inclusive learning, with over 80% of beneficiaries from underserved communities. The organization was honored with the Best CSR Initiative award by the Government of Tamil Nadu for its impactful contributions.
